Birth and Death certificate Statutory Provision
Every birth shall be registered within 14
days and every death shall be registered.
Any person who wants to register a birth shall
inform the concern office in the prescribed
format (Appendix) along with a certificate
from the person or Medical Institution, who
conducted delivery in the case of.
Beyond the prescribed time limit, if a registration
is done, it is accepted with a payment of
penalty up to a period of one year. If a registration
is to be done beyond a period of one year,
it will be registered only on receipt of judicial
order from a Magistrate and with penalty.

Extract
Birth Register
On registration one copy of an extract of
Birth Register will be given to the party,
free of cost. If a certificate of Birth is
required at a later date from the Town Panchayat,
an application in the prescribed format (Copy
of format enclosed in Appendix) furnishing
the information required in the format like
name of the child, father's name, mother's
name, date and place of birth, etc
